Wells Fargo & Company $WFC Stock Holdings Lessened by Union Bancaire Privee UBP SA

Union Bancaire Privee UBP SA lessened its stake in shares of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E:WFCFree Report) by 20.5% in the first qu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 40,371 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 10,399 shares during the period. Union Bancaire Privee UBP SA’s holdings in Wells Fargo & Company were worth $3,055,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E:WFCG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, April 14th. The financial services provider reported $1.60 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.58 by $0.02. The company had revenue of $11.62 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$21.85 billion. Wells Fargo & Company had a return on equity of 13.27% and a net margin of 17.26%.The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 6.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$1.39 EPS. As a group, analysts predict that Wells Fargo & Company will post 6.99 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Wells Fargo & Company Company Profile

(Free Report)

Wells Fargo & Company is a diversified, U.S.-based financial services company headquartered in San Francisco, California. Founded in 1852 by Henry Wells and William G. Fargo, the firm has evolved from its origins in express delivery and pioneer-era banking into one of the largest full-service banks in the United States. The company provides a broad range of financial products and services to individual, small business, commercial, and institutional clients. Charles W. Scharf serves as chief executive officer.

Wells Fargo operates across several core business segments, including consumer banking and lending, commercial banking, corporate and investment banking, and wealth and investment management.
